In Sugar Land, Texas, a city known for its master-planned communities and family-friendly atmosphere, maintaining and enhancing backyard swimming pools is a priority for many homeowners, particularly those in areas like First Colony. As pools age, their surfaces can degrade, leading to aesthetic issues and potential structural problems. Pool resurfacing offers a comprehensive solution, revitalizing both the appearance and the integrity of your pool. The process involves completely removing the existing plaster or aggregate finish and preparing the concrete shell for a new coating. Homeowners can select from a wide array of durable and attractive materials, including robust quartz aggregates, smooth pebble finishes, or elegant tile accents, each suited to the Texas climate. Beyond simple resurfacing, remodeling opens up possibilities for integrating modern amenities such as custom water features, energy-efficient LED lighting, or advanced filtration systems, creating a truly personalized aquatic retreat. Remodeling your pool is a custom project, so final costs depend heavily on the specific upgrades you select. Replacing simple pool tiles or updating your plaster is generally more affordable than installing entirely new decking, lighting systems, or automation features. The physical size of your pool and the current condition of the plumbing underneath also play a major role in the total bill. The actual resurfacing process in Sugar Land generally takes between 3 to 7 days to complete. This duration can vary based on the specific materials chosen and any additional remodeling features being incorporated. The professionals meticulously prepare the pool surface before application. A proper curing period follows before refilling the pool. This ensures a durable and beautiful finish.

The best time to resurface a pool in Sugar Land is typically during the cooler, less humid months of fall and winter. These conditions are ideal for the proper curing of new pool surfaces, ensuring maximum durability. Scheduling during these times can also lead to quicker project completion. Common pool remodeling options in Sugar Land include upgrading to durable quartz or pebble finishes, installing new tile coping, or adding water features like sheer descents. Energy-efficient LED lighting is another popular enhancement. Professionals can also integrate swim-up bars or tanning ledges. These upgrades create a modern backyard sanctuary.
In Sugar Land, preparation involves draining the pool and meticulously removing the old surface using specialized equipment. The concrete shell is then thoroughly inspected for any damage, and necessary repairs are made. The surface is cleaned and prepared to ensure optimal adhesion of the new material. This detailed process is critical for a lasting finish.
